Lindisfarne Anglican Grammar School is seeking applications from accomplished Humanities Teachers, preferably with experience teaching Ancient History at HSC level.
You will bring a wealth of pedagogical expertise, a proven track record in curriculum leadership, and a strong commitment to working collaboratively with colleagues. You will play a pivotal role in shaping the development of our students and fostering a culture of high performance and professional growth.
This fixed-term, full-time role is being offered to cover a staff member on leave for the duration of 2027.
The salary will be commensurate with the successful applicant's skills, qualifications, and experience, based on the teaching salaries outlined in the Independent Schools NSW Teachers Cooperative Multi-Enterprise Agreement 2025 ($94,155-$133,009).
